And if not, tell Jake Gyllenhaal. The actor, who has just presented his latest film, ‘The Covenant’, spoke with Variety in the premiere of the tape on this subject and stated: “There are many musicals that I like deeply.“
“At some point, I would like to perform ‘Fiddler on the Roof’. I would love to do it,“shared the interpreter.
His godmother, Jamie Lee Curtis, who was also present at the premiere, joined the conversation and shared a school memory of Gyllenhaal. The actor’s interest in that particular musical is not causal. It turns out that he was about to star in a version of it in his high school, a few years ago. However, his professional career had other plans for him.
The theatrical representation coincided with the filming of his film, ‘Sky in October’, from 1999. The independent film was enough for Gyllenhaal to put aside his musical dream. “I knew then how committed he was to being an actor, because a lot of people wouldn’t have given up acting for a small, independent film,Curtis commented.
“Many would have said, ‘No, I’m going to star in my school musical,” continued the actress. “I realized that his dedication to art was different from wanting to be very famous or seek a lot of attention.“
In ‘The Covenant’, directed by Guy Ritchie, we will see Gyllenhaal in the shoes of an American sergeant during the War in Afghanistan. After being seriously injured, he will try to help the translator of his unit (Dar Salim) to escape from the Taliban regime, to take him to the United States. The film will hit theaters on April 21.
